Summary

The path to change moves from Awareness ➡️ Acceptance ➡️ Action. Did you know that we tend to spend most of that process hanging out between Awareness and Acceptance? Once acceptance truly occurs, action usually follows within days, but moving from awareness to acceptance can take YEARS. Yes, years! In this episode, Layci takes a deep dive into the process of change with Chad Peterson, owner of PTI Transportation. Chad and Layci cast a wide net in this conversation, covering topics that range from their trailer park childhood, grappling with stigmas from one end of the socioeconomic spectrum to the other, and of course, confessions of terrible leadership and subsequent change and growth.
